Biography
Samira S Farouk MD, MSCR, FASN is an Assistant Professor in the Division of Nephrology at the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ai. (ISMMS). She is also the Associate Director of the Nephrology Fellowship Program. She is board certified in Nephrology. Dr. Farouk is a graduate of Princeton University and Robert Wood Johnson Medical School - Rutgers University. She completed her residency and fellowship training in Internal Medicine, Nephrology, and Transplant Nephrology at ISMMS.
